Online car dealers' warranty excludes pre-existing defects as maintenance

A buyer received a Carvana vehicle that developed mechanical issues 8 days after delivery. The warranty provider classified spark plugs, transmission fluid, and worn brakes as routine maintenance, leaving the buyer with $718+ in costs. This exploits ambiguity between "defect" and "maintenance" to deny claims on cars with pre-existing issues.

Remote Jellyfin Access Requires Choosing Between Convenience and Privacy

Self-hosting Jellyfin for remote streaming forces users into unacceptable trade-offs: Tailscale requires extra apps and manual toggling, Cloudflare raises TOS and privacy concerns, and reverse proxies expose open ports. No solution delivers reliable remote access with full data sovereignty and minimal setup friction. The self-hosting community has been stuck on this problem for years.
